The AI Image Generation Cost Calculator estimates and compares the cost of producing images using major AI platforms including DALL-E 3, Midjourney, Stable Diffusion, and other generative AI services. As AI-generated imagery becomes essential for marketing, content creation, game development, and design prototyping, understanding cost differences across platforms is critical for budgeting. Pricing models vary dramatically — from per-image API charges (DALL-E 3 at $0.040-$0.120 per image) to monthly subscriptions (Midjourney at $10-$60/month) to near-zero marginal cost when self-hosting open-source models like Stable Diffusion. This calculator helps users estimate total costs based on their expected volume, preferred resolution, and chosen platform.
Total Cost = Number of Images x Cost per Image. For subscription models: Effective Cost per Image = Monthly Subscription / Images Generated per Month. For self-hosted: Cost per Image = (GPU Cloud Cost per Hour / Images per Hour) + Storage Cost.

At DALL-E 3's standard quality and 1024x1024 resolution, 500 images cost 500 x $0.040 = $20.00/month. This is pure pay-per-use with no subscription commitment. At HD quality (1024x1792), the same 500 images would cost 500 x $0.080 = $40.00/month.
Midjourney Standard costs $30/month with approximately 15 hours of fast GPU time (~900 images). At 200 images/month, the effective cost is $30/200 = $0.15/image. If the designer used their full allocation of 900 images, the effective cost drops to $0.033/image — cheaper than DALL-E. The key insight: subscription value depends entirely on utilization.

Adobe Firefly includes 250 generative credits with Creative Cloud All Apps ($54.99/mo). The remaining 750 images at $0.035/credit cost $26.25. Total = $54.99 + $26.25 = $81.24. However, if the team already pays for Creative Cloud, the marginal cost is only $26.25 for 750 extra images ($0.035/image), making it very cost-effective.

Batch Generation and Bulk Discounts
OpenAI's API does not offer volume discounts for DALL-E — the per-image price is the same whether you generate 1 or 100,000 images. Midjourney offers effective volume discounts through higher subscription tiers. Self-hosted Stable Diffusion achieves the best economics at scale because the fixed GPU cost is amortized across more images.
Image Upscaling and Editing Costs
Generating a base image is often just the first step. Upscaling (2x or 4x resolution), inpainting (editing portions), and outpainting (extending the canvas) each incur additional costs. On DALL-E, each edit or variation is a separate API call at full price. On Midjourney, upscaling consumes fast GPU time. Factor in 2-3 generations per final image for accurate budgeting.
Running Your Own GPU vs. Cloud Rental
Purchasing an NVIDIA RTX 4090 (~$1,600) for local Stable Diffusion generation can break even versus cloud GPU rental in 2-4 months at high volume (1,000+ images/day). However, this requires technical setup, electricity costs (~$0.10-$0.30/kWh), and maintenance. For most users, cloud GPUs offer better flexibility.
| Platform | Pricing Model | Cost per Image |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| DALL-E 3 (Standard 1024x1024) | Per-image API | $0.040 | Low volume, API integration |
| DALL-E 3 (HD 1024x1792) | Per-image API | $0.080 | High-quality marketing assets |
| Midjourney Basic | $10/month subscription | ~$0.05 (at 200 images) | Hobbyists, light use |
| Midjourney Standard | $30/month subscription | ~$0.033 (at 900 images) | Freelancers, moderate volume |
| Midjourney Pro | $60/month subscription | ~$0.033 (at 1,800 images) | Agencies, heavy use |
| Stable Diffusion (self-hosted) | GPU compute cost | $0.002-$0.01 | High volume, full control |
| Stability AI API (SD3) | Per-image API | $0.03-$0.065 | API integration, moderate volume |
| Adobe Firefly | Included + credits | $0.035/credit | Creative Cloud users |
Which AI image generator is cheapest per image?
At high volumes (1,000+ images/month), self-hosted Stable Diffusion is cheapest at roughly $0.002-$0.01 per image. At moderate volumes (200-500/month), a well-utilized Midjourney subscription can be as low as $0.03-$0.07 per image. DALL-E 3 via API is $0.04-$0.12 per image regardless of volume, making it most cost-effective for low-volume or sporadic use.
Does DALL-E 3 charge for failed or rejected generations?
Yes, OpenAI charges for each API call regardless of whether you use the result. If the content filter rejects a prompt, you are generally not charged. However, if an image is generated but you don't like it, you still pay. Using detailed prompts and testing with cheaper models first can reduce wasted spend.
How does Midjourney pricing work?
Midjourney offers four subscription tiers (2025): Basic ($10/mo, ~200 images), Standard ($30/mo, ~900 images with 15hr fast GPU), Pro ($60/mo, ~1,800 images with 30hr fast GPU), and Mega ($120/mo, ~3,600 images with 60hr fast GPU). All tiers include unlimited relaxed-mode generations, which are slower but do not consume fast GPU hours.
Can I use AI-generated images commercially?
DALL-E 3 (OpenAI), Midjourney (paid plans), Stable Diffusion (open source), and Adobe Firefly all grant commercial usage rights for images generated on paid plans. However, copyright ownership of AI-generated images remains legally unsettled — the U.S. Copyright Office has stated that purely AI-generated images without meaningful human creative input cannot be copyrighted.
What are tokens/credits and how do they relate to image cost?
Some platforms use credit or token systems rather than direct pricing. Adobe Firefly uses 'generative credits' (1 credit per image). Stability AI's API charges per-image based on resolution and steps. OpenAI charges per API call. Always convert credits to a per-image dollar cost for accurate comparison across platforms.
Pro Tip
For most small teams generating 100-500 images per month, Midjourney Standard ($30/month) offers the best balance of quality, speed, and cost. For API-driven applications that need programmatic image generation, DALL-E 3 is the simplest to integrate via OpenAI's API. Only invest in self-hosted Stable Diffusion if you consistently need 1,000+ images per month or require fine-tuned models for a specific visual style.

The first image sold at auction that was created by AI — 'Portrait of Edmond de Belamy' by the Obvious art collective using a GAN (Generative Adversarial Network) — fetched $432,500 at Christie's in 2018. The actual compute cost to generate the image was estimated at less than $100, representing perhaps the highest markup in art history at over 4,000x the production cost.
